Mutations are special versions of pets in Steal an Egg that can increase their Money per second. Besides changing the appearance of a pet, each Mutation also adds a multiplier to its base earnings. Some Mutations can be obtained naturally by hatching Eggs, while others require the Fuse Machine, Admin Abuse events, or the Sakura Incubator.

If you are trying to build the strongest possible pet collection, understanding how each Mutation works is important. A good Mutation combined with a heavy and valuable pet can result in a much higher income.

All Mutations in Steal an Egg

There are currently five main Mutations that you can find in Steal an Egg. Each one has a different multiplier, with Spirit Bloom providing the highest boost among the listed Mutations.

Here are all the Mutations and their multipliers:

  • Silver — 1.25x multiplier
  • Bloom — 1.5x multiplier
  • Golden — 2x multiplier
  • Rainbow — 2.5x multiplier
  • Spirit Bloom — 3x multiplier

The multiplier is applied to the pet’s base Money per second. This means Mutation is not the only thing that determines how much a pet earns. Pet size and weight are still important. A large pet with a strong base earning rate can become much more valuable after receiving a powerful Mutation.

How to Get Silver Mutation

Silver gives your pet a 1.25x earnings multiplier. It is one of the standard Mutations and can be obtained through several different methods.

You can get Silver Mutation from:

  • Hatching Eggs
  • Using the Fuse Machine
  • Admin Abuse events

Because there are multiple ways to obtain Silver, you may eventually get one naturally while progressing through the game. You can also find special Eggs during Admin Abuse events that already have a Mutation associated with them.

How to Get Bloom Mutation

Bloom is a Sakura Mutation that provides a 1.5x multiplier to your pet’s base earnings.

Unlike Silver, Golden, and Rainbow, Bloom is obtained through the Sakura Incubator. When using the incubator, Bloom has a 97.5% chance of being selected.

The Sakura Incubator is located in the Cherry Blossom Biome. Before you can use it, you need to unlock access by submitting a Crane.

Once the incubator is available, you can place an Egg inside and use Sakura Crystals to charge it. After the process is completed, the Egg can receive one of the Sakura Mutations.

How to Get Golden Mutation

The Golden Mutation gives pets a 2x multiplier. This makes it a significant upgrade over Silver and can greatly increase the income of a pet with a good base value.

Golden Mutation can be obtained through:

  • Hatching Eggs
  • The Fuse Machine
  • Admin Abuse events

Some Eggs can have a golden appearance, which can indicate a possible Mutation. However, you should not assume that every Egg with a special appearance will always result in the Mutation you want.

How to Get Rainbow Mutation

Rainbow is another standard Mutation and provides a 2.5x multiplier to base pet earnings.

You can obtain Rainbow Mutation from:

  • Hatching Eggs
  • The Fuse Machine
  • Admin Abuse events

Rainbow is stronger than Silver and Golden, making it a desirable Mutation when you are trying to improve your best pets.

Similar to Golden Eggs, certain Eggs can have a rainbow appearance. These can indicate a Mutation, although the appearance alone does not necessarily guarantee the exact result.

How to Get Spirit Bloom Mutation

Spirit Bloom is currently the strongest Sakura Mutation listed in this system. It provides a 3x multiplier to your pet’s base Money per second.

You can only obtain Spirit Bloom through the Sakura Incubator.

The chance is:

  • Spirit Bloom — 2.5%
  • Bloom — 97.5%

Because Spirit Bloom only has a 2.5% chance, getting it can take several attempts. Even if you fully charge an Egg, there is still no guarantee that the result will be Spirit Bloom.

This is why valuable Eggs are usually better targets for the Sakura Incubator.

How to Get Mutations by Hatching Eggs

The easiest way to encounter standard Mutations is by simply hatching Eggs. Silver, Golden, and Rainbow can appear when you hatch an Egg, giving the resulting pet an additional earnings multiplier.

There is also a possibility of receiving more than one Mutation on a pet. For example, a pet can potentially have combinations such as Golden + Silver, which can make it much more valuable than its normal version.

Some Eggs may also have different colors or appearances that suggest they could produce a Mutated pet. However, these visual indicators should not be treated as a guaranteed result.

How to Get Mutations With the Fuse Machine

The Fuse Machine provides another method for obtaining standard Mutations. To use it, you need to combine three copies of the same pet.

Pets that have better stats than their normal Index values can have a higher chance of producing standard Mutations when fused. This makes the Fuse Machine useful when you have several duplicate pets sitting in your inventory.

However, using three pets does not guarantee that the resulting pet will have a Mutation. You still need some luck when performing the fusion.

How to Get Mutations During Admin Abuse

Admin Abuse events can also provide opportunities to obtain Mutated pets. These events are generally associated with game updates and can include special spawns, Eggs, and Mutation opportunities.

During these events, Admins can spawn Eggs with specific Mutations. Some events may also provide pets with unusually high base earnings, making them particularly valuable.

If you are actively looking for rare or strong Mutations, it is worth paying attention when a new update is released because Admin Abuse can introduce opportunities that are not available during normal gameplay.

How to Use the Sakura Incubator

The Sakura Incubator is the main method for obtaining the two Sakura Mutations: Bloom and Spirit Bloom.

To use it, you need to:

  1. Unlock the Cherry Blossom Biome.
  2. Submit a Crane to unlock the Sakura Incubator.
  3. Obtain an Egg you want to improve.
  4. Place the Egg inside the Sakura Incubator.
  5. Use Sakura Crystals to charge the Egg.
  6. Complete the incubation process.
  7. Receive either Bloom or Spirit Bloom.

You can also put an Egg that already has a regular Mutation into the Sakura Incubator. The existing Mutation can remain while the Egg receives an additional Sakura Mutation.

This means you can potentially create a pet with multiple effects rather than replacing the Mutation it already has.

What Is the Best Mutation?

Based purely on the listed multiplier, Spirit Bloom is the best Mutation because it provides a 3x multiplier to the pet’s base earnings.

The Mutation ranking by multiplier is:

  • S Tier — Spirit Bloom: 3x
  • A Tier — Rainbow: 2.5x
  • B Tier — Golden: 2x
  • C Tier — Bloom: 1.5x
  • D Tier — Silver: 1.25x

However, Mutation alone does not determine whether a pet is good. A large pet with high base earnings and a weaker Mutation can still outperform a smaller pet with a stronger Mutation.

For the best results, try to combine high pet weight, strong base earnings, rarity, and a powerful Mutation.

Mutations are an important part of progressing in Steal an Egg, especially when you want to increase your Money per second. The standard options are Silver, Golden, and Rainbow, while the Sakura Incubator adds Bloom and Spirit Bloom to the game.

Among them, Spirit Bloom has the highest listed multiplier at 3x, but its 2.5% chance makes it much harder to obtain than Bloom. If you have a valuable Egg with high weight or rarity, using the Sakura Incubator can be a good way to try and push its potential even further.
